Domino’s Invites NRL Fans To Break Bread Ahead Of State Of Origin One

State of Origin is back for 2022, and while most fans will be divided by the bitter rivalry Domino’s has chosen to encourage peace with their latest campaign.

With the first game of the 2022 series coming up this Wednesday, Domino’s has invited fans from both Queensland and NSW to renounce their rivalries and embrace mateship instead, all in the name of free pizza.

Both Domino’s Toowong (Queensland) and Domino’s Five Dock (NSW) will be decorated in half blue and half maroon, and will be giving away free pizzas to the first 100 customers who arrive between 3pm and 5pm on Wednesday 8th June with a mate wearing the opposite jerseys.

Each pairing will receive a free pepperoni pizza (or simply cheese, if you’re more of a vegetarian fan) to break bread and share a slice with their friend/rival ahead of the match in the evening.

Domino’s ANZ CEO David Burness said that while rivalries tend to heat up during Origin, Domino’s is encouraging footy fans to set aside their differences.

“At Domino’s, we know that our pizza brings people closer. That is why our “Store of Two Sides” has been created, to bridge the gap between Maroons and Blues supporters,” said Burness.

“Maroons fan? Simply bring a mate who supports the Blues to either Domino’s Toowong or Domino’s Five Dock for your chance to score a free Pepperoni Pizza to share (or vice versa). And those who prefer a vegetarian option will be gifted a Simply Cheese instead!”

“To keep the spirit of unity alive, we’re encouraging customers to do the same; after all, state versus state doesn’t have to mean mate versus mate, especially when there is pizza involved!”

Customers are being encouraged to place their pizza orders ahead of the game to beat the rush, as pizza lovers and footy fans unite in preparation for the first of three State of Origin throwdowns.
